What are two effects of the French and Indian awards that escalated tension between the American colonist and British government
Elena L [17]

The French and Indian War, known also as the Seven Years War (1754-1763). The war doubled Britain's national debt and this led to the imposition of heavy taxes on the British colonists in America. The resistance of the colonists to these taxes led to the American Revolutionary War.
